Cannot Start Game
« on: September 16, 2004, 09:51:58 am »

Using WinXP


Installed as "Executables Only"
Unzipped the 3 content files (music,content,voice) to  \packages
Downloaded and placed keys.cfg (newest) into \content
uqm.exe crashes with kernel error

Kernel failed to load!


Do I have to boot of a DOS floppy or something?

Do not unzip the content files. Place them still zipped in the packages dir. Also, you shouldn't install a keys.cfg file yourself. It will be created in the correct location (which is not "content") the first time the game is run.

The game won't work under pure DOS, so you can forget about using DOS floppies.

i reinstalled and this time left them zipped
works great!
